    By investigating the zeros of abelian integrals, the authors show that for \(\ell = 2n + 1\) and \(\ell = 2n + 2\), for \(0 < \epsilon \ll 1\) the perturbation \(x' = y + \epsilon \sum_{k = 0}^\ell a_k x^k\), \(y' = -x\) of the canonical linear center has at most \(n\) limit cycles. They study the cases \(n = 2\) and \(n = 3\) in detail, for example giving necessary and sufficient conditions for the appearance of three limit cycles when \(n = 3\).
